Wireless AirOS Global AP Syslog Level configuration command 7.4.121.0

Hello
I have a controller 5508 running on version 7.4.121.0. With the command "show ap config global" I can check the global AP syslog config:
AP global system logging host.................... 0.0.0.0
AP global system logging level................... informational
Default the syslog host ip is 0.0.0.0. With the command ">config ap syslog host global x.x.x.x" I can configure the IP of the syslog server.
Question:
How can I configure the global syslog level?
I searched in the command reference but there is no specific command to set the global AP syslog level.
Thanks,
Rolf

Hi Rolf,
Here is the command you required
config ap logging syslog level <syslog_level> all   
This post also should give you an idea how to configure syslog in different WLC platforms & how to analyze them using splunk
http://mrncciew.com/2014/09/19/wlc-syslog-analysis/
Pls mark the thread as "answered" if this is you looking for. 
HTH
Rasika

    Hi Matt,
    The problem here is that the AP you received is a Lightweight AP which is meant to be used with Wireless Lan Controllers and WCS. The "LAP" portion of the part number shows this Lightweight designation. This can be converted to an Autonomous/stand-alone AP that you desire;
    Here is a conversion method;
    Reverting the Access Point Back to Autonomous Mode
    http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/hw/wireless/ps430/prod_technical_reference09186a00804fc3dc.html#wp161272
    You can convert an access point from lightweight mode back to autonomous mode by loading a Cisco IOS Release that supports autonomous mode (Cisco IOS release 12.3(7)JA or earlier). If the access point is associated to a controller, you can use the controller to load the Cisco IOS release. If the access point is not associated to a controller, you can load the Cisco IOS release using TFTP.
    Using a TFTP Server to Return to a Previous Release
    Follow these steps to revert from LWAPP mode to autonomous mode by loading a Cisco IOS release using a TFTP server:
    Step 1 The static IP address of the PC on which your TFTP server software runs should be between 10.0.0.2 and 10.0.0.30.
    Step 2 Make sure that the PC contains the access point image file (such as c1200-k9w7-tar.122-15.JA.tar for a 1200 series access point) in the TFTP server folder and that the TFTP server is activated.
    Step 3 Rename the access point image file in the TFTP server folder to c1200-k9w7-tar.default for a 1200 series access point, c1130-k9w7-tar.default for an 1130 series access point, and c1240-k9w7-tar.default for a 1240 series access point.
    Step 4 Connect the PC to the access point using a Category 5 (CAT5) Ethernet cable.
    Step 5 Disconnect power from the access point.
    Step 6 Press and hold MODE while you reconnect power to the access point.
    Step 7 Hold the MODE button until the status LED turns red (approximately 20 to 30 seconds) and then release.
    Step 8 Wait until the access point reboots, as indicated by all LEDs turning green followed by the Status LED blinking green.
    Step 9 After the access point reboots, reconfigure it using the GUI or the CLI.

  • Lightweight AP Syslog Level

    Does anyone out there know if there's a way to control the syslog level lightweight APs use for trap logging? I know it's possible to configure them to log to a particular host instead of the default of the 255.255.255.255 but I can't find any command or option to change the trap logging level. It apparently defaults to emergencies and I'd like to set to informational instead to capture additional log data.
    Thanks,
    Brandon

    Below should help you to do this. If you want to do it for a AP then you need to type AP name instead of all. Also make sure APs get register to your controller before doing this.
    config ap logging syslog facility   all
    config ap logging syslog level informational all
    config ap syslog host global
    You can verify by using below commands
    show ap config global
    show logging
    show ap config general

    The AP has been converted to lightweight:
    C1240-K9W8-M
    The K9W8 is lightweight and K9W7 is autonomous.  You need a WLC for the K9W8.  If you have an autonomous image, you can convert it back:

  • Different syslog level logging on the switch

    Hi,
    How do I log the messages on a switch to a syslog server at syslog level 3 but on the switch itself I would log at syslog level informational?
    Could anyone advise how should I go about doing this?
    Thanks.

    Hi Christina,
    Which switch you are having? But yes it is possible and I am posting the configuration for one of the common switch 2950
    configure terminal
    logging console 6
    logging trap 3
    logging monitor 6
    logging host

  • Internal LAN adapter configuration commands

    Could anyone describe me the meaning of hsma
    command option:
    7206MEDA(cfg-lan-Token 0)#adapter 1 4000.0047.4522
    7206MEDA(cfg-adap-Token 0-1)#?
    Internal Lan Adapter configuration commands:
    hsma Hot Standby MAC Address parameters
    Thanks in advance for any information

    Hi,
    I have attached a document describing what hsma is all about in more detail, including sample configurations.
    In very simple words. It is a mechanism, a little bit like hsrp, to allow to cip's to backup each other. You configure a virtual adapter which is always only active on one of the two cip's and they monitor each other. If one cip goes down, the other one takes over and activates the virtual adapter.
    When the two cip routers were connected to a tokenring infrastructure than the redundancy whas achived by using the same mac address on the cip's reachable over to different source bridged path using different rif's.
    If you connect the two cip routers via a ethernet than there is no rif field in your packets anymore, you can not do source bridging. Additional the cam table of a ethernet switch can not deal with two times the same mac address on different ports in the same vlan.
    Hsma allows for a similar level of redundancy if your cip routers are connected via a ethernet backbone.

    Hi,
    If you can shed some bucks you should go for RAID 10 for all files. Also as a best practice keeping database log and data files on different physical drive would give optimum performance. Tempdb can be placed with data file or on a different drive as per
    usage. Its always good to use dedicated drive for tempdb
    For memory setting.Please refer
    This link for setting max server memory
    You should monitor SQL server memory usage using below counters taken from
    this Link
    SQLServer:Buffer Manager--Buffer Cache hit ratio(BCHR): IIf your BCHR is high 90 to 100 Then it points to fact that You don't have memory pressure. Keep in mind that suppose somebody runs a query which request large amount of pages in that
    case momentarily BCHR might come down to 60 or 70 may be less but that does not means it is a memory pressure it means your query requires large memory and will take it. After that query completes you will see BCHR risiing again
    SQLServer:Buffer Manager--Page Life Expectancy(PLE): PLE shows for how long page remain in buffer pool. The longer it stays the better it is. Its common misconception to take 300 as a baseline for PLE.   But it is not,I read it from
    Jonathan Kehayias book( troubleshooting SQL Server) that this value was baseline when SQL Server was of 2000 version and max RAM one could see was from 4-6 G. Now with 200G or RAM coming into picture this value is not correct. He also gave the formula( tentative)
    how to calculate it. Take the base counter value of 300 presented by most resources, and then determine a multiple of this value based on the configured buffer cache size, which is the 'max server memory' sp_ configure option in SQL Server, divided by 4 GB.
      So, for a server with 32 GB allocated to the buffer pool, the PLE value should be at least (32/4)*300 = 2400. So far this has done good to me so I would recommend you to use it.  
    SQLServer:Buffer Manager--CheckpointPages/sec: Checkpoint pages /sec counter is important to know about memory pressure because if buffer cache is low then lots of new pages needs to be brought into and flushed out from buffer pool, 
    due to load checkpoint's work will increase and will start flushing out dirty pages very frequently. If this counter is high then your SQL Server buffer pool is not able to cope up with requests coming and we need to increase it by increasing buffer pool memory
    or by increasing physical RAM and then making adequate changes in Buffer pool size. Technically this value should be low if you are looking at line graph in perfmon this value should always touch base for stable system.  
    SQLServer:Buffer Manager--Freepages: This value should not be less you always want to see high value for it.  
    SQLServer:Memory Manager--Memory Grants Pending: If you see memory grants pending in buffer pool your server is facing SQL Server memory crunch and increasing memory would be a good idea. For memory grants please read this article:
    http://blogs.msdn.com/b/sqlqueryprocessing/archive/2010/02/16/understanding-sql-server-memory-grant.aspx
    SQLServer:memory Manager--Target Server Memory: This is amount of memory SQL Server is trying to acquire.
    SQLServer:memory Manager--Total Server memory This is current memory SQL Server has acquired.

  • Infrastructure Audit Level configuration

    Hello,
    I''ve searched in MDS tables to found where is stored the configuration value of the SOA Infrastructure Audit Level, but I couln't find it, Can anyone tell me where is persisted this configuration?
    Thank in advance.

    Yes, in this tables are stored the audit details/data generated by the executed instances, but I'm asking for the configuration of this audit details, I want to know where are persisted this possibles values for the SOA Infrastructure audit level configuration property:
    Inherit     Inherits the audit level from infrastructure level.
    Off     No audit events (activity execution information) are persisted and no logging is performed; this can result in a slight performance boost for processing instances.
    Minimal     All events are logged; however, no audit details (variable content) are logged.
    Error     Logs only serious problems that require immediate attention from the administrator and are not caused by a bug in the product. Using this level can help performance.
    Production     All events are logged. The audit details for assign activities are not logged; the details for all other activities are logged.
    Development:     All events are logged; all audit details for all activities are logged.
